    Description

      Currently we have NFC module that seems to be only useful for reading smartcards, but cannot be used with USB-connected devices on desktop platforms. It would be good to support smartcard readers on desktop platforms too. Perhaps using pcsclite on Unix-like systems. PCSClite API is based on Windows PCSC API (https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/win32/api/winscard/).

      It may be possible to use the same API as used for NFC, it will be misnamed then.

      Note that neard support (QTBUG-97943) seems much less usable on Linux, unless I'm missing something.

      PCSC is used by Qt-based AusweisApp, the code there does seem to support Windows too.

      macOS was using a fork of PCSCLite in the past for smart card access, that is not the case anymore. CryptoTokenKit is the API to use on macOS.
